Gino Parrodi

  • Class Senior
  • Hometown Queretaro, Mexico
  • Highschool Woodlands (Houston, Texas)

Biography


2011-12:  Second Team All-OVC ... finished his senior season with the second best stroke average of 73.0 behind 25 rounds... earned seven Top 20 finishes, including twice nabbing individual runner-up honors in consecutive Butler Invitationals in Florida... tied for 17th at the end-of-season league meet... owned a fine career stroke mark of 74.3 as a Panther, behind 85 total rounds and 6,314 shots.

2010-11:  Ended his junior year with the third lowest stroke mark of 76.2... notched four Top 20 finishes... that included a Top 5 mark at the Western Illinois Invite, tying for fourth... also had a season-low three-round five-under-par 211 total at the Butler Fall Invite... tied for 28th at the year-ending Ohio Valley Conference championship.

2009-10: OVC 'Golfer of the Week' (3/31/10)... followed up a nice freshman season by leading the squad with a 74.2 stroke average, behind five Top 20 places...behind one Top 5 and three Top 10 finishes... competing in all nine events, the sophomore had a season-best fourth place, one-over-par 72 score at the Butler Spring Invite... in fact he led all Panthers in three spring meets.

2008-09: OVC All-Newcomer Team... made an immediate impact in his freshman season, earning a spot on the league All-Newcomer unit as he competed in nine events... finished with the second best stroke average, in just his first year as a Panther, behind his 75.2 mark... that includes tying for 21st place at the Butler Fall Invitational as he fired a five-over-par score... also ended up in the Top 25 at the season-ending OVC Tournament, tying for 24th.

HS: Earned two letters as a junior and senior for coach Steve Cribari at Woodlands HS in Houston, Texas... team earned a 5A state championship in 2007, where he tied sixth individually... team was also state runner-up in 2008... earned the October, 2007 school Highlighted Highlander Award... played for Texas squad when they competed in the Scotland Cup... also a Mexico representative to International Cup, where he captured the match play championship.
